In the Shekhawati region, the primary use of a chowki is as a low surface to dine on. However, it is also used in religious spaces to place offerings on, like in the Vagad region. This fairly new chowki was used in the courtyard of a temple with offerings (prasad and holy water) placed on it.

  • Title: Chowki (Low surface)
  • Location: Bagar, Jhunjhunu, Rajasthan
  • Type: Sapaat (Surface)
  • Contributor: Mansi S Rao, Ben Cartwright and Samrudha Dixit
  • Rights: Design Innovation and Craft Resource Centre, CEPT University and South Asian Decorative Arts and Crafts Collection (SADACC) Trust
  • Medium: Metal (Iron), Wood
  • Wood Craft Technique: Joinery, Turning, Painting
  • Region: Shekhawati
  • Metal Craft Technique: Fittings
